Led by Julie Loison.
Arts Award supports children and young people to enjoy the arts, develop creative and leadership skills and achieve a national qualification.
A chance for young people interested in the arts to enhance their knowledge, understanding and creative skills by working towards the Bronze, Silver or Gold Arts Award. Each term is 10 weeks long. Participants will also see two live events at Norden Farm as part of the cost of the term.
Suitable for all abilities.

Translated by Christopher Hampton and presented by Red Hot Theatre. A playground altercation between two eleven year old boys brings their parents together to resolve the matter.
Initially diplomatic niceties are observed but as the meeting progresses and the rum flows, tensions emerge and the gloves come off.
WHY? An elegant, acerbic and entertaining study in the tension between civilised surface and savage instinct. Reza's sharpest work since Art.
